WebThe cumulative distribution function (CDF) of random variable X is defined as FX(x) = P(X ≤ x), for all x ∈ R. Note that the subscript X indicates that this is the CDF of the random …

The cumulative distribution function of a real-valued random variable $${\displaystyle X}$$ is the function given by where the right-hand side represents the probability that the random variable $${\displaystyle X}$$ takes on a value less than or equal to $${\displaystyle x}$$.
